+ | * NEW: Those same Hubitat status messages are now automatically added to a Unit property called “Status Message” and another Unit Property “Status Timestamp” will be the date/time when the current message was received. This way you can trap them in a script, or add a custom column to any List window to show them if you wish rather than just logging them. The above checkbox for logging the status messages does not have to be turned on to send this info to the Unit Properties. This is always done. | ||

+ | * NEW: The Interface List window also shows a percent of memory use for the plugin instance and any child processes after the CPU Usage number. | ||
+ | * NEW: A new option in the Interface List window lets you chose if the CPU Usage calculation is done based on 100% a single CPU core, or 100% being every CPU available in the machine. So if you have 10 cores and you chose individual then 100% would be using a full core, but per machine that would only be 10% of the overall machine load. Whichever makes more sense to you when viewing it. The numbers are usually very low and so many not show up on the graph at all unless you increase their values by setting it to per CPU. Plugins that are using GPU resources or that are using helper apps may show as using more than 100% if per CPU is selected. This is OK. | ||

- | ====9.4.47 Change Log:==== | ||
- | * All plugins that previously used the system install of Python2 have been upgraded to run with the embedded python3 version. This makes the app more easily compatible with the latest MacOS versions that no longer include the older python version by default. This did necessitate many changes to the plugins themselves and while they have been running just fine here and for the beta testers there may still be some gotchas in there. If you experience any issues as your plugins are starting up please copy and paste the log entries of any errors and email them to me. | ||
